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
566 43 692 033
0255908597 072296492 15925
0255908597 072296492 15925
33 51967 8902070
All about undefined
Interested in learning more?
0255908597 072296492 15925
33 51967 8902070
See more
1133837 0679075 3925060
83 2836 76 73822968994
See more
392481186 13418948555
82991 797150 028173 8263347
See more